2026-2027 Chief Justice Application   

(Application timeline will be announced at a later date) 


 

  • 3.0 cumulative GPA as calculated by the Office of the Registrar

  • Must have been a member of SGA for a minimum of two semesters

  • Good standing with the University and no formal disciplinary record

  • May not hold office in any other branch of SGA while serving as Executive Officer

  • Maintain full time status (at least 12 credit hours) during Academic year

  • Contribution to all efforts of SGA and commitment to make SGA a top extracurricular activity

  • Attendance at all SGA Senate meetings on Wednesdays at 5:00pm.

  • Participate in SGA programming, activities, and events.

  • Fulfillment of SGA Office hours (Excluding required meetings of the respective office, it is expected each officer maintain five office hours during the Academic year)

  • Be confidential with cases that are heard

  • Fulfillment of all obligations regarding respective position as outlined in the SGA Constitution and By-Laws.

The Student Tribunal Selection Committee is comprised of the SGA President, Vice-President, Chief Justice, current serving Justice, and current serving Senator. The selection of the new Chief Justice will be made within a week of the application deadline.
